Watch C3 Smartwatch
Product Information
The product is a Class B digital device that has been tested and
found to comply with the limits set forth in part 15 of the FCC
Rules. The device is designed to provide reasonable protection
against harmful interference in a residential installation. The
device generates, uses, and can radiate radio frequency energy. If
not installed and used in accordance with the instructions
provided, it may cause harmful interference to radio
communications.
Note that there is no guarantee that interference will not occur
in a particular installation. If the device causes harmful
interference to radio or television reception, which can be
determined by turning the equipment off and on, the user is
encouraged to try to correct the interference by one or more of the
following measures:
-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.
- Increase the separation between the equipment and
receiver. - Connect the equipment into an outlet on a circuit different
from that to which the receiver is connected. -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/TV technician for
help.
